I recently read that Microsoft will soon start asking users of Internet Explorer 6 to upgrade to Internet Explorer 8. Microsoft says IE6 is very old technology and may not work well for modern web sites. They also noted IE6 has security weaknesses that are corrected in IE8.
The table below shows browsers used by folks visiting our class web site. About 17 percent of the visits between January 1 and April 13 of this year used IE6. If you use IE6 or IE7 and want to upgrade your browser, you can use IE 8, Firefox, or the Google Chrome browser and be reasonably confident that any of those browsers will do a good job for you on our web site.
| Browser | Visitors | % of Total Visitors | |
| 1 | Internet Explorer 7.x | 1,511 | 60.76% |
| 2 | Internet Explorer 6.x | 413 | 16.61% |
| 3 | Google Chrome | 203 | 8.16% |
| 4 | Unnamed Others | 104 | 4.18% |
| 5 | Firefox | 100 | 4.02% |
| 6 | Internet Explorer 8.x | 27 | 1.09% |
| 7 | 26 Other Special Purpose Browsers | 129 | 5.19% |
| Total | 2,487 | 100.00% |
